Как эффективно использовать стеки, очереди и списки: советы и фото

В этом разделе вы найдете полезные советы и фото по использованию структур данных, таких как стек, очередь и список, для улучшения вашего программирования.


Стек идеально подходит для задач, требующих последнего вошедшего элемента первым вышедшим (LIFO).

Очередь как структура данных. Динамические структуры данных #5

Используйте очередь для задач, требующих первого вошедшего элемента первым вышедшим (FIFO).

Стек как структура данных. Полное понимание! Динамические структуры данных #4

Списки являются универсальными структурами данных, подходящими для хранения упорядоченных коллекций элементов.

ЗОЖ быстрого приготовления от студии вкуса MODERATO

Для повышения эффективности работы с большими данными используйте двусвязные списки.

Вам нужно знать только 3 структуры данных

При работе со стеком используйте методы push и pop для добавления и удаления элементов соответственно.

#55. Реализация стека (пример использования структур) - Язык C для начинающих

Очереди можно реализовать с помощью двух стеков для оптимизации операций.

Структуры данных: списки, стек, очередь, дэк в JavaScript

Используйте циклическую очередь для более эффективного использования памяти.

Python Stacks - Python Tutorial for Absolute Beginners - Mosh

Списки в Python поддерживают динамическое изменение размера, что делает их очень гибкими.

Лекция 13-1-all. Односвязный список. Реализация. Стек и очередь на его основе.

Для многозадачности и асинхронного программирования используйте очереди в качестве буферов.

#17. Реализация стека на Python и C++ - Структуры данных

Правильное использование структур данных может значительно улучшить производительность вашего кода.

12 Стек, очередь и дек